Hi Jay, what was your thought process behind starting your own business?
Starting this business was an obvious choice. We have been servicing the disc golf community for roughly 5 years. 2 years ago is when we filed for an LLC. Almost 1 year ago was the grand opening of our retail store. We were fortunate enough to find a niche market to move into with enough support to survive.

What should our readers know about your business?
We are evolving into more than just a local retail store. We are working with several different entities to spread awareness and grow the sport of disc golf. Anything from running local events, donating equipment to schools, installing courses to teaching new players. We keep ourselves busy.
